Common Mistakes (150 words)

Hell, even seasoned travelers get tripped up by promo codes. You see that '15% off' banner and your brain goes straight to checkout. But slow down, cher.

*

Assuming it works sitewide: That code? Might only work on full-price items. Or worse, exclude brands you actually want.

*

Forgetting to check expiration: Damn, that code was good yesterday. Today? Nada.

*

Missing minimum spend: You're at $49, code needs $50. You're outta luck.

*

Not stacking: Some sites let you layer codes. Others? One and done.

*

Ignoring cashback: Why grab 15% off when you could get 15% off and 5% cashback?

Minimum Spend Requirements (100 words)

Minimum spend requirements are the pre-heat temp of promo codes. Too low, your weld's gonna crack. Too high? You're wasting time.

*

Common thresholds: $50, $100, $150.

*

Watch the math: That $49 item? Gonna cost you $50 to use the code.

*

Exclusions apply: Sometimes sale items don't count toward minimum spend.

Example: Code needs $100 minimum spend. Your cart's at $98. Add a $5 belt, save 15% on $103.
